Maharashtra CM Orders To Remove Objectionable Content Against Chhatrapati Sambhaji Maharaj, Details Here

Maharashtra Chief Minister Devendra Fadnavis has ordered the state's cyber police to take action against "objectionable" content related to Chhatrapati Sambhaji Maharaj on Wikipedia

Maharashtra Chief Minister Devendra Fadnavis on Tuesday said the state cyber department has been directed to remove objectionable content against Chhatrapati Sambhaji Maharaj from the encyclopaedia “Wikipedia.”

“We strongly condemn the kind of statements written against Chhatrapati Sambhaji Maharaj on Wikipedia. We have instructed our cyber department officials to take necessary action and communicate with the relevant authorities managing the platform to ensure that such misinformation is removed immediately.” said Fadnavis while speaking to reporters in Mumbai.

The directions from CM came after objectionable content against Chhatrapati Sambhaji Maharaj was found on Wikipedia, which triggered outrage on social media platforms.

---Advertisement---

Notably, last week, Vicky Kaushal’s starrer “Chavva” was released, after which many people visited Wikipedia, and they found objectionable content. Later, people demanded action on social media.
